On 12/03/2012, the Supreme Court heard Kailash's Special Leave Petition challenging a High Court of M.P. judgment from 26/10/2010. The petitioner failed to appear even on the second call. The Court dismissed all Special Leave Petitions, finding no cogent reason to interfere with the High Court's impugned judgment, though it condoned the delay in filing.
